Certain treadmills feature specific features that make them better suitable for specific types of workouts. If you want to perform hill training or intervals, you should opt for treadmills with more top-speed and an incline range. They can be powered by either an electric motor or manual one. The horsepower rating of the motor is commonly used to describe it, but continuous horsepower (CHP) is the best way to gauge the treadmill's power. CHP is a measure of the power treadmill motors can generate over time, as opposed to the power it produces at its peak.

Space

Whether you're shopping for treadmills to use at home or in your gym, the amount of space required is an important aspect. A lot of people look at the dimensions of the model they're interested in but only think about how it will be used in their home or fitness studio. This can cause people to purchase a treadmill that's too large for their desired space or does not have the features they want.

The amount of room between the front and behind of the treadmill must be taken into account. This extra space is crucial if you need to quickly get off the treadmill if you slip or lose your balance. If you're working at an exercise facility, the American Society for Testing and Materials recommends a minimum space of 39'' between treadmills sale, and 78'' behind each machine. This is to prevent accidents that can result in serious injuries or even death.
